So the aim of the Klondike free solitaire game is to eventually take apart all the tableau piles (and empty the stock) by transferring all cards into four stacks (called foundations) in the upper right part, each of the one suit, starting with Aces and ending with Kings. Play free online games in Microsoft Start, including Solitaire, Crosswords, Word Games and more. Once you emptied one of the piles completely you can start or move a new pile (or single card) here, starting with a King card. You can move a single card, a part of any pile or a complete pile on top of any other pile, but according to this rule - alternate colors and downwards order. Contrary to that the tableau piles are built down by alternate colors. Foundations are built up by suit, starting from Ace, then Two, Three and up to King. Your goal in free Klondike solitaire is to build the four foundations (in the rectangles in the upper right part). The remaining cards are placed in the stock at the upper left of the layout (face down). In each pile, all of the cards are placed face down except for the last one which is upturned. From left to right, each column contains one more card, so the first one contains just one card, the second one - two cards and so on. After shuffling, a tableau is set up with seven columns of cards. You play this free Klondike Solitaire with a standard 52-card deck (no Jokers). The tower, its front archway and the main building's facade are conspicuously off-centre relative to one another. At its summit stands a 2.7-metre-tall (9 ft) gilt metal statue of Saint Michael, the patron saint of the City of Brussels, slaying a dragon or demon. Above the roof of the Town Hall, the square tower body narrows to a lavishly pinnacled octagonal openwork. By 1455, this tower, replacing the older one, was complete. The 96-metre-high (315 ft) tower in Brabantine Gothic style is the work of Jan van Ruysbroek, the court architect of Philip the Good. Historians think that it could be Guillaume (Willem) de Voghel who was the architect of the City of Brussels in 1452, and who was also, at that time, the designer of the Aula Magna at the Palace of Coudenberg. The architect of this west wing is unknown. As a result, a second, somewhat longer wing was built on to the existing structure, with the young Duke Charles the Bold laying its first stone in 1444. Initially, future expansion of the building was not foreseen, however, the admission of the craft guilds into the traditionally patrician city government apparently spurred interest in providing more room for the building. The architect and designer is probably Jacob van Thienen with whom Jean Bornoy collaborated. This wing, together with a shorter tower, was built between 14. The oldest part of the present building is its east wing (to the left when facing the front). Due to the square's tumultuous history (see details below), it is also its only remaining medieval building. The Town Hall (French: Hôtel de Ville, Dutch: Stadhuis) of the City of Brussels was erected in stages, between 14, on the south side of the Grand-Place/Grote Markt, transforming the square into the seat of municipal power. This site is served by the premetro (underground tram) station Bourse/Beurs (on lines 3 and 4), as well as the bus stop Grand-Place/ Grote Markt (on line 95). Since 1998, is also listed as a UNESCO World Heritage Site, as part of the square. Its three classicist rear wings date from the 18th century. Įrected between 14, the Town Hall is the only remaining medieval building of the Grand-Place and is considered a masterpiece of civil Gothic architecture and more particularly of Brabantine Gothic. It is located on the south side of the famous Grand-Place/Grote Markt (Brussels' main square), opposite the neo-Gothic King's House or Bread House building, housing the Brussels City Museum. The Town Hall ( French: Hôtel de Ville, Dutch: Stadhuis ⓘ) of the City of Brussels is a landmark building and the seat of the City of Brussels municipality of Brussels, Belgium. For in-place servers, it is the project root.Ī local file/folder is any file or folder under the project root.Ī remote file/folder is any file or folder on the server. The server configuration root is the highest folder in the file tree on the local or remote server accessible through the server configuration. To access files on the server, use FTP/SFTP/FTPS/WebDAV protocols. In the remote server configuration, a server runs on another computer (a remote host). In the local server configuration, you do your development, then copy the sources to the server.Ī local server is a server that is running in a local or a mounted folder and whose document root is NOT the parent of the project root. Usually, it is the publicly-accessible base folder for a website. The document root is the server root or website root directory. The document root of an in-place server is the parent of the project root, either immediate or not. In the in-place server configuration, the server is running on your computer, your project is under its document root (for example, in the /htdocs folder), and you do your development directly on the server. Taking into account all the above, let's define the following basic concepts related to synchronization between WebStorm and servers. Anytime you are going to use a server, you need to define a server access configuration, no matter whether your server is on a remote host or on your computer. Interaction between WebStorm and servers is controlled through server access configurations. The latter can be ensured only for local files, that is, files that are stored on you hard disk and are accessible through the file system. To provide efficient coding assistance, WebStorm needs to re-index code fast, which requires fast access to project files. All this functionality is based on the project files index which WebStorm builds when the project is loaded and updates on the fly as you edit your code. The reason to stick to this "local development - deployment" model lies in the way WebStorm provides code completion, code inspections, code navigation, and other coding assistance features. Writing may be difficult due to medication side effects that cre ate muscular or visual problems using a variety of tech support or devices can be helpful.Īllowing extra time for exams, to be negotiated before the exam, allows the student to focus on the exam content instead of the clock, and lessens the chance that anxiety or other symptoms will interfere with his or her performance.ĭividing an exam up into parts and allowing the student to take them in two or three sessions over 1-2 days helps reduce the effect of fatigue and allows the student to focus on one section at a time. If note takers are not available, then securing notes from another student helps free him or her to attend and participate more fully in class.Īltering an exam from a multiple choice format to an essay format may help students demonstrate their knowledge more effectively and with much less interference from anxiety or a learning disability. Similar to above, having someone in class to take notes alleviates the anxiety of having to capture all the information sometimes the anxiety of attending class interferes with effective note taking. Helps student anticipate and manage anxiety, stress, or extreme restlessness caused by medication.Īlleviates pressure of note taking, freeing the student to attend and participate more fully in class. Helps alleviate dry mouth or tiredness caused by medications. Similar to an accompanier, a volunteer assistant may help take notes or provide informal support. Assign classmate as a volunteer assistant.Having someone (another student for example) accompany a student to class and/or stay in class with the student. Seating in a preferred location, by the front door, or to reduce audio/visual distractions. T h ese are provided as examples of potential accommodations but note that every student has different needs and preferences and each of the suggestions should be tailored to the individual. Note that every student has different needs and preferences and each of the suggestions should be tailored to the individual. Academic adjustments are intended to allow students with disabilities to successfully master their coursework and are not intended to circumvent academic standards or requirements. The examples below of potential accommodations are provided for descriptive purposes only. For college students with psychiatric and mental health conditions, and resulting disabilities, academic accommodations may include adaptations in the way specific courses are conducted, the use of extra technology or equipment, supports, or modifications in academic requirements. Many colleges and universities have both the diversity of resources and the flexibility to provide aids or services as accommodations. To understand it, Chrome is the application that allows you to browse the internet and access any web page, among other functions, while Google is a website that allows you to search for all kinds of information on the internet by entering keywords and displaying results that match the user's search intention. It is common to confuse these two terms due to the great integration that exists between these two almost inseparable pieces. Is Google Chrome a browser or a search engine?Ĭhrome is a web browser that integrates the Google search engine as its main search engine. Being cross-platform and even available for Smart TVs, we can synchronize our Google account in Chrome so that all our devices share the same settings, favorites, extensions, etc. Its main function allows you to visit all kinds of web pages quickly and securely, although the loading speed will also depend on your internet connection. It also stands out for its tabbed browsing, which allows you to have multiple pages open in the same window, which is really useful. The main virtues of this free web browser for Windows are its speed and stability when loading any type of web page. Chrome was launched in 2008 as a great alternative to Internet Explorer and Firefox, and over the years it has become the most used web browser with over 1 billion active users.ĭespite being proprietary software, it is based on the open-source web browser Chromium, which is very similar. What is Google Chrome and what is it used for?Ĭhrome is a free web browser developed by the multinational company Google, which is also the owner of the largest Internet search engine under the same name, as well as other famous applications such as Google Drive, Gmail, Google Docs, and many more. |
